Brian Muna

Brian Muna, Guam Native, is an established filmmaker on island with eight years of experience in the industry. His filmmaking credits also include commercial work for corporations on island and has also worked abroad for projects filmed in Japan and Taiwan for Illest and had volunteered for a short-form documentary filmed in the Philippines (2017) aimed to support a non-profit organization.
Under his company, Brian Muna Films, he has directed, written, filmed and produced numerous short films and music videos and has collaborated with other local artists, creatives and filmmakers alike.
In 2015, Brian wrote, co-directed, and produced the short film Luther — An agent is captured eight years after going rogue. His interrogation dissects parts of his past, which lead to an impending revelation. — an official selection at the 2015 Guam International Film Festival (GIFF) and received the award for Best Made in the Marianas. Another film he directed, Madam (2015) — A (fiction) film that depicts the harsh world of human sex trafficking in a non-relenting plight. — was also screened and nominated alongside Luther at the GIFF.
Since then, he has been behind the camera, lensing and directing viral videos such as Inifresi (2016) and the music video collaboration with A Long Drive Home and Acoustic Attack for Breathe (2017).
